So I am new to jogging and running for long periods again. Even brisk walking for that matter. I have been trying to do this everyday but I am wondering do I occasionally need to have a rest day for my legs sake? If so how often?

You should absolutely rest your legs, I started off slow then went to every day running and my knees definitely let me know I can't, but even if you are not feeling the pain you should give yourself at least 2 days off a week so that you don't burn out your muscles or your motivation.

Hey there, ok so if u just started i is NOT recommended to run evr day and exhaust urself. Ur body needs rest, esp if u r not used to it. U cud injure urself easily if u keep running like a maniac like that, I'm basing that on my own experience. I suggest u run 3 times a week, and on the other days just do free weights at home, get 8-10# dumbbells to begin with and do 3 sets of 1-12 reps. Try to do weights 3 times a week for now in between running days or as another option u cud weights train in am and then go for ur run if u r a tough cookie and can handle it u know Wink As far as best time for fat loss, there is no such a thing. Just run whenever, make sure u had carbs an yr or 2 before u go tho. So u have fuel to keep going. Hope it helps. Let me know if u have any other questions Wink
